minimum processor state goes back to 100% after restart
Inspiron 1501 with vista home premium
Every time I restart the computer the minimum processor state is set to 100%. This makes it run hot and the fan runs all the time.
Changing the setting in:
Control Panel\Power Options\Edit Plan Settings
Change advanced power settings
Processor power management
Minimum processor state
to a lower value than 100% corrects the problem until I restart the computer. Then its back to 100% again. So right now I have to manually change the setting every time I turn it on or else it runs hot.
An ideas why the setting isn't staying as I set it?
